Integrated medical, police, legal, and counselling support, plus shelter for up to five days, for women facing violence.
Women's mobility composite score in Azamgarh is 30.5%, behind the typical district. 80.8% of women take part in all three major household decisions, better than the typical district. The Sakhi One-Stop Centre supports women whose safety and agency fall short of this.
